RESULTS OF INVESTIGATION : Examination showed that the "nuts" as listed in the ingredient statement were not present. Organoleptic examination revealed no rum or brandy flavor. The mandatory information was in part inconspicuous due to the fact that the label was placed partly under the can lid, thereby concealing the manufacturer's name and address, quantity of contents statement, and list of ingredients. LIBELED : On or about 2-19-63, S. Dist. N.Y. CHARGE: 403(a)—when shipped, the label statements "Rum and Brandy Flavored" and "Nuts" were false and misleading; and 403(f)—the informa- tion required to appear on the label under sections 403(e) (1) and (2), 403 (i)(2), and 403(k), namely, the name and address of the manufacturer, packer, or distributor; the quantity of contents statement; the common or usual name of each ingredient; and the declaration of artificial flavoring and a chemical preservative, "was not prominently placed thereon with such conspieuousness (as compared with other words, statements, designs, or devices in the labeling) as to render it likely to be read by the ordinary individual under customary conditions of purchase and use. DISPOSITION: 3-2^63. Default—^destruction.
